Option 1 — Myntra's Own Photoshoot Service

Myntra offers a managed photoshoot service through its seller portal (Myntra Partner Portal). Under this service, you ship products to a Myntra-empanelled studio, they shoot and upload images directly to your listings.

Myntra photoshoot service pricing (approximate, 2025–26):

Image typePrice per style (approx.)
Ghost mannequin (front + back)₹250–400
Flat lay (front)₹150–250
Model photography (1–2 looks)₹500–800
Detail / close-up shots₹100–150 per additional shot

Prices vary by seller tier, catalogue volume, and city. Check your Myntra Partner Portal for current rates.

Pros of Myntra's service:

  • Images are pre-approved for Myntra's quality standards
  • Direct upload to listings — no manual upload
  • Managed logistics through Myntra's network

Cons:

  • Higher cost per style than independent studios for large volumes
  • Less control over styling and background
  • Not usable for other platforms (Amazon, Flipkart, your own website) — images belong to Myntra's system

Option 2 — Independent Studio Photography

Most mid-to-large Myntra sellers (especially in Gujarat) use independent photography studios for their catalogues. This gives them:

  • Lower cost per piece for bulk shooting
  • Images usable across all platforms (Myntra, Amazon, Flipkart, website)
  • Full control over styling and brand consistency

Independent studio pricing (Gujarat, 2025–26):

ServicePrice per piece
Flat lay photography₹150–250
Ghost mannequin (front + back)₹250–400
Model photography (1 look)₹500–900 (includes talent fee)
Detail close-up (per shot)₹100–200

Myntra Image Requirements — What You Need to Know

Before booking any photoshoot for Myntra, understand the platform's image requirements:

Apparel — Myntra Image Standards

SpecificationRequirement
Image dimensionsMinimum 2000 x 2667px (3:4 ratio portrait for apparel)
FormatJPEG
BackgroundWhite (RGB 255,255,255) for standard; lifestyle accepted in secondary
Model / ghost mannequinRequired for structured garments — flat lay not preferred
Fit requirementGarment must be properly fitted (no loose hang)
QualitySharp focus, no blurring, no noise

Ghost Mannequin vs. Flat Lay on Myntra

Myntra strongly prefers ghost mannequin or model photography for structured apparel (kurtas, dresses, blazers, sarees with blouse). Flat lay is acceptable for accessories, scarves, and some casual tops, but ghost mannequin images perform significantly better in search and conversion on Myntra.

For sellers with budget constraints, flat lay is better than nothing — but invest in ghost mannequin as soon as volume justifies it.

Model Photography on Myntra

Model images are permitted and preferred for certain categories:

  • Western wear (tops, dresses, jeans)
  • Lingerie and swimwear
  • Premium and luxury fashion
  • Accessories (jewellery, bags, shoes)

Model images for Myntra should show the complete look, with the model in a neutral pose against a clean white or light grey background.


Ghost Mannequin Photography — What It Is and How It's Done

Ghost mannequin (invisible mannequin) photography is a technique where the garment is shot on a mannequin, then the mannequin is removed in post-processing — giving the garment a three-dimensional, structured appearance with a "hollow" body effect.

Why Myntra sellers use ghost mannequin:

  • Shows garment structure and fit without a visible mannequin
  • Cheaper than model photography (no talent fee)
  • Consistent, repeatable look across large catalogues
  • Preferred by structured apparel categories

How it's done:

  1. Garment is dressed on a standard mannequin
  2. Front and back shots are taken
  3. A "neck joint" or "sleeve insert" shot is taken separately (inner lining detail)
  4. Images are composited in post-processing to create the ghost effect

Price range for ghost mannequin in Gujarat: ₹250–400 per piece, depending on complexity and number of shots required.


What Affects the Cost of a Myntra Photoshoot?

1. Volume

Higher volume = lower per-piece cost. At 100+ pieces per batch, independent studios typically offer ₹150–250 per piece for flat lay and ₹200–350 for ghost mannequin.

2. Garment Complexity

Simple flat garments (t-shirts, scarves) are quick to shoot. Complex garments (sarees with heavy embroidery, bridal lehengas with multiple pieces) take longer and cost more.

3. Number of Angles

Standard ghost mannequin is front + back (2 shots). Adding side views, sleeve close-ups, or label detail shots increases cost.

4. Model vs. Mannequin

Model photography costs significantly more due to the talent fee. Budget ₹500–1,500 per look (per model change), depending on whether you use a freelance model or a studio with in-house talent.

5. Styling and Props

Ghost mannequin and flat lay don't need props. Lifestyle and model shots may require styling — clothing accessories, shoes, backdrop choice. Styling adds ₹500–2,000 per session depending on complexity.


How to Reduce Myntra Photoshoot Costs

Shoot in Large Batches

Per-piece cost drops significantly with volume. Consolidate your seasonal catalogue into one batch rather than shooting 10 pieces at a time.

Prepare Garments Before Shipping

Steam and iron every garment before sending. Every crease your photographer has to steam adds time — and time costs money.

Use Ghost Mannequin Over Model

For most Myntra categories, ghost mannequin performs as well as or better than model photography at 40–60% of the cost.

Choose the Right Studio

Myntra-empanelled studios have higher per-piece costs because of overheads and their managed service infrastructure. An independent studio with strong Myntra track record will deliver compliant images at lower cost.

Bundle Multiple Platforms

If you sell on Amazon and Flipkart as well as Myntra, use the same shoot to produce images for all three platforms. Most high-resolution images shot to Myntra's 3:4 ratio can be cropped or padded for Amazon's 1:1 ratio.


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Can I use the same photos on both Myntra and Amazon? Yes, with minor adjustments. Myntra requires a 3:4 portrait ratio (2000 x 2667px) while Amazon uses square (1:1) or landscape formats. A professional studio can deliver both crops from the same shoot.

Q: Does Myntra check image quality before listing? Yes. Myntra's quality check (QC) team reviews images before they go live. Common rejection reasons: blurry images, incorrect aspect ratio, visible mannequin, off-white background, garment not properly fitted.

Q: How long does a Myntra photoshoot take? For a batch of 25 pieces (ghost mannequin), expect 1 business day of shooting and 1–2 days for retouching and compositing. Total turnaround from product receipt to image delivery: 2–3 business days.
